查莉成长日记观后感第一篇嘿,朋友们!我刚看完《查莉成长日记》,心里那叫一个激动,忍不住来和你们唠唠。
这部剧真的太有趣啦!里面的每一个角色都好像是生活在我身边的朋友。
查莉这个小宝贝,那萌萌的样子简直能把人的心都融化了。
看着她一点点长大,从学说话到学走路,每一个小小的进步都让人忍不住为她鼓掌。
还有她的哥哥姐姐们,那相处的日常真是又好气又好笑。
他们会吵架,会闹别扭,但关键时候总是团结在一起,那种亲情的温暖真的特别感人。
特别是爸爸妈妈,他们在孩子的成长过程中,有时候也会手忙脚乱,可那份对孩子们满满的爱始终不变。
我觉得这部剧最棒的地方就是它特别真实。
就像我们自己的家庭一样,有欢笑,有泪水,有烦恼,但更多的是爱和温暖。
每次看到他们一家人围坐在一起分享快乐或者一起面对困难,我就特别羡慕。
感觉这就是我理想中的家庭生活呀。
《查莉成长日记》让我感受到了家庭的重要,也让我明白了成长的路上虽然会有各种磕磕绊绊,但只要有爱,一切都能迎刃而解。
